The Return of Warm Wood Tones


For several years, white and grey kitchen areas controlled style fads, providing a tidy and innovative aesthetic. While these combinations still have their area, homeowners are gravitating toward abundant, warm wood tones that bring deepness and personality back right into the kitchen. C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is gaining back appeal, including a natural and classic feeling to the room. These natural elements create a sense of warmth that contrasts wonderfully with contemporary devices and fixtures, making the kitchen area feel inviting and lived-in.


Traditional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ship


Shaker-style cupboards, beadboard details, and intricate moldings are resurfacing as preferred choices in kitchen renovations. Property owners appreciate the craftsmanship and personality that typical closet styles provide. The simplicity of shaker closets makes them functional, pairing well with both contemporary and vintage-inspired decoration. Glass-front closets are also seeing a rebirth, supplying a classy method to showcase valued crockery and glassware while including an open, ventilated feel to the kitchen area.

Bringing Back the Butcher Block Countertop


While stone kitchen counters like quartz and granite have been preferred for their toughness, many homeowners are finding the appeal and performance of butcher block kitchen counters. The warmth of timber countertops not only improves a classic kitchen visual yet also provides a sensible surface area for meal prep work. Whether made use of as a complete kitchen counter or as an accent on a kitchen area island, butcher block surfaces bring a feeling of rustic charm and capability to any kind of space.

The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ets


Few elements stimulate classic kitchen design quite like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not only aesthetically enticing however also highly practical, fitting large pots and frying pans easily. Combined with bridge faucets, which feature a timeless, exposed-plumbing appearance, these sinks add to the old-world charm that many homeowners are desire. The combination of these components mixes background with modern-day ease, making them a must-have for anybody seeking to restore a classic kitchen aesthetic.
